Best Water Engineer Certifications
Professional Engineer (PE) License – Civil (Water Resources)
Certification Provider
National Council of Examiners for Engineering and Surveying (NCEES)
Best for
This certification is best for water engineers seeking to advance into senior or supervisory roles. It is also essential for those who want to work as consultants or lead public infrastructure projects. Engineers aiming for career growth and increased responsibility will benefit most from this credential.
Description
The PE License in Civil Engineering with a focus on Water Resources is a highly respected credential for water engineers. It demonstrates advanced knowledge in water systems, hydrology, hydraulics, and environmental regulations. Obtaining this license requires passing the Fundamentals of Engineering (FE) exam, gaining relevant work experience, and passing the PE exam. This certification is often required for higher-level engineering positions and for signing off on projects. It is recognized across the United States and is a mark of professional competency.
Certified Water Treatment Operator
Certification Provider
American Water Works Association (AWWA) or state regulatory agencies
Best for
This certification is ideal for water engineers working in water treatment plants or those responsible for water quality management. It is also beneficial for engineers involved in the design and optimization of treatment processes. Entry-level and mid-career professionals will find this certification particularly valuable.
Description
This certification validates expertise in the operation and management of water treatment facilities. It covers topics such as water chemistry, treatment processes, safety, and regulatory compliance. Certification levels vary based on experience and education, allowing for career progression. It is often required for those working directly with municipal or industrial water treatment plants. The credential ensures that operators can maintain safe and effective water quality standards.
Certified Floodplain Manager (CFM)
Certification Provider
Association of State Floodplain Managers (ASFPM)
Best for
This certification is best for water engineers involved in flood risk management, urban planning, or disaster mitigation. It is also valuable for those working with government agencies or consulting firms on floodplain projects. Engineers seeking to specialize in flood management will benefit most from this credential.
Description
The CFM credential demonstrates expertise in floodplain management, including flood risk assessment, mitigation, and regulatory compliance. It is recognized nationally and is often required for professionals involved in floodplain mapping, planning, and policy development. The certification process includes an exam and ongoing continuing education. It helps ensure that engineers are up-to-date with the latest floodplain management practices. This certification is highly regarded in both public and private sectors.

Certified Environmental Engineer (CEE)
Certification Provider
American Academy of Environmental Engineers and Scientists (AAEES)
Best for
This certification is best for water engineers specializing in environmental projects or those seeking to demonstrate advanced technical skills. It is ideal for senior engineers, consultants, or those pursuing leadership roles. Engineers working on multidisciplinary projects will benefit from this credential.
Description
The CEE credential recognizes advanced expertise in environmental engineering, including water and wastewater treatment, pollution control, and environmental impact assessment. It requires a combination of education, experience, and passing a rigorous exam. The certification is respected in both public and private sectors and demonstrates a high level of professional achievement. It is particularly valuable for engineers involved in complex environmental projects. The CEE credential is a mark of excellence in the field.
